210 likes | 215 Vues
CLIP: the new UNL information system. Antóni o P orto Pro-Rector New University of Lisbon. Context: the “NOVA Digital” project. Contribute to the efficiency and quality of UNL by sharing information services acceding each user autonomously at any time and place to authorized services
E N D
CLIP:the new UNL information system António Porto Pro-Rector New University of Lisbon
Context:the “NOVA Digital” project • Contribute to the efficiency and quality of UNL by sharing information services • acceding • each user autonomously • at any time and place • to authorized services • obtaining • storage, integration, diffusion and retrieval of information • using • a shared infra-structure • connectivity (internal and external) • servers (Data Center) • plataforms (Oracle, CLIP, Plone, ...) • applications (POC, Academic management, UNL site, …) CLIP: the new UNL information system
Approach • Centralized IT management • Resources • Human • Material • Quality of service • Decentralized information management • User enpowerment CLIP: the new UNL information system
CLIP • Campus Life Integration Platform • Fully integrated information system CLIP: the new UNL information system
Vision • integration of all information • single system • universal interface • implicit individual customization • instantaneous update effects • comprehensive process coverage CLIP: the new UNL information system
Two sub-projects • Process: reengineering UNL with CLIP • “Front-office” outlook • information registered at its source • Role reversal of archival technology • database vs. paper – original vs. copy • Multiple viewpoints • Automatic data consolidation and statistics • Technology: software support (PETISCO) • Declarative programming • High-level abstraction CLIP: the new UNL information system
Integration:all information is related • single database • Consistency • official information source • integrated conceptual model • Flexibility in definitions • services • access control CLIP: the new UNL information system
Individuality:each user is unique • single authentication • user-centred services • authorized services • authorizations as groups • users belong to groups student record personal schedule course management CLIP: the new UNL information system
Instantaneity:what you see is up-to-date • fully dynamicgeneration of service content • no extra processesbetween information entry and use • data in services • user access CLIP: the new UNL information system
Effects • Efficiency and productivity • Front-office vs. back-office • distributed data entry • Elimination of paper circuits • inversion: original / copy paper / digital • Transparency • Quantity • observables / observers • Quality • actual, consistent, official • Community • sharing processes / results CLIP: the new UNL information system
In-house technology development • Applied research • use research results • induce interesting research • Opportunity for student projects • High capacity for change • Maintenance • Improvement • user feedback • New services CLIP: the new UNL information system
User’s view • Channels to services • Navigation context • point of view • authorization • Parameterchoice CLIP: the new UNL information system
Access control • Explicit authentication id / password • Implicit authorization group • Group • intensional descriptions • Expressiveness • algebraic composition • Modularity • individual extension Delegation CLIP: the new UNL information system
Implemented services • Curricula management • Study programs • Versions • Paths, areas, credits • Curricular plans • Courses: compulsory, blocks, … • Dependencies • Prerequisites, equivalences, … CLIP: the new UNL information system
Implemented services • Student lifecycle • Application • Admission • Payments • Course enrollment • Study path change • Termination • Certificates and diplomas • Multiple views • student records, class and exam schedules, etc. CLIP: the new UNL information system
Implemented services • Academic year • Admissions • Courses on offer • Teaching duties • Classes, teacher assignments • Class scheduling • Timetables, room assignments • Student enrollment in classes • Choice of classes in a course • Exam scheduling CLIP: the new UNL information system
Implemented services • Course management • Descriptions • Objectives, program, bibliography, etc. • Student load breakdown for ECTS credit rating • Class definition • Type, number • Teacher assignment • Activity summaries • Grade registration • Views on enrolled students CLIP: the new UNL information system
Implemented services • Statistics • Students • Admissions, enrollments, diplomas • Parametric filtering • Institution, level, program, year, … • Grades • Parametric filtering • Institution, department, program, course, year, … CLIP: the new UNL information system
Current and next developments • Study program submission • New and revised programs • Structure and documentation • Automatic information package • Study programs and courses • Erasmus mobility • Institutional agreements • Outgoing and incoming students • Application form • Learning agreement • Transcript of records CLIP: the new UNL information system
Conclusions (1) • Overall satisfaction of “clients” • less unwanted manual work • much greater transparency • greater sense of community • Good supporting technology • reliable implementation • fast development / maintenance • emerging paths for improvement No fear of code rewrite! CLIP: the new UNL information system
Conclusions (2) • Political difficulties • The autonomy issue (Faculties vs. University) • Trust in central organization • Control • Equity • Budget • Fear of change CLIP: the new UNL information system